In Ayurveda medicine, the liver is an intricate organ with a multitude of responsibilities. This vital organ not only produces bile for the breakdown of fatty acids but also generates blood-clotting factors, preventing clots from obstructing the circulatory system. Sugar Conversion and Glycogen Storage: Fuelling Muscular Energy

The liver’s ability to convert sugar into glycogen serves as a crucial mechanism for providing energy to our muscles. This stored glycogen, released in the form of glucose energy, supports muscular functions and overall physical activity. Synthesis of Proteins, Cholesterol, and Essential Nutrients

Delving deeper, the liver emerges as a hub for synthesizing proteins, cholesterol, and storing essential trace elements such as iron, copper, and Vitamins A, D, and B12. Ayurveda’s Perspective: The Liver as the Seat of Pitta Dosha

In Ayurveda, the liver assumes a central role as the “seat” of Pitta dosha, embodying the fiery mind-body element associated with metabolism. Ayurvedic wisdom recognises the liver’s daily involvement in digestion, metabolism, and the production of vital compounds. Transformation of Plasma to Blood: Maintaining Purity

Ayurveda highlights the liver’s responsibility for converting clear plasma (Rasa Dhatu) into blood (Rakta Dhatu). This transformative process not only nourishes the body but also safeguards the blood’s purity by identifying and storing toxins, preventing their entry. Ayurvedic Diet Tips: A Culinary Approach to Liver Health

Ayurvedic dietary recommendations for liver health include the avoidance of toxins in food and the preference for organic, freshly-cooked meals. Steering clear of preservatives, chemicals, and processed foods alleviates the liver’s detoxification burden. Furthermore, specific dietary guidelines for different doshas, such as a PITTA-PACIFYING DIET in summer, offer tailored approaches to maintain liver balance.

Lifestyle Harmony: Balancing Act for Liver Well-being

Ayurveda extends its focus beyond diet to lifestyle adjustments that promote liver harmony. Timely meals, early bedtime, and stress reduction through practices like Transcendental Meditation are advocated. Recognising the impact of sleep on liver function underscores the importance of quality rest in maintaining metabolic balance and overall well-being.
